$63B inflow: Dubai draws thousands of millionaires despite tensions

Dubai continues to defy geopolitical and economic uncertainties by attracting a staggering $63 billion inflow from wealthy individuals. Despite ongoing regional tensions and global market volatility, the emirate remains a magnet for millionaires seeking both security and opportunity. This influx not only reinforces Dubai's position as a global financial hub but also reshapes its sociocultural landscape.

Steady growth amid geopolitical challenges

Even as tensions rise across the Middle East and beyond, Dubai has maintained a steady flow of high-net-worth individuals investing in its real estate, financial services, and luxury markets. The city's ability to remain politically stable and offer robust infrastructure plays a critical role in attracting capital despite external conflicts unduly impacting other regions.

Record-breaking $63 billion capital inflow

The $63 billion recorded inflow marks a historic peak in Dubai’s financial landscape. This unprecedented volume includes investments from private wealth, institutional investors, and corporate entities keen on leveraging the emirate's tax advantages, world-class amenities, and strategic location between East and West.

Luxury real estate market: magnet for millionaires

Dubai’s luxury real estate sector sees substantial activity as millionaires flock to own high-end residences and commercial properties. The demand drives up prices in key districts such as Palm Jumeirah and Downtown Dubai, showcasing the emirate’s appeal as a premium address for global elites.

Economic diversification fueling investor confidence

Dubai’s strategy to diversify beyond oil has paid off considerably, drawing investments in technology, tourism, finance, and logistics. These sectors offer resilient growth opportunities, which instills greater confidence in affluent investors looking for diversified portfolios with potential for long-term returns.

Favorable regulatory environment and tax benefits

Dubai’s regulatory framework is crafted to facilitate ease of doing business, including 100% foreign ownership in many sectors, no income tax, and minimal bureaucratic hurdles. These advantages create a fertile ground for millionaires seeking to safeguard their wealth while optimizing growth.

Quality of life: luxury and security measures

The emirate offers a luxurious lifestyle complemented by world-class healthcare, education, and entertainment options. Additionally, stringent security policies and political stability provide peace of mind for those relocating their assets and families amid regional unrest.

Rise of fintech and innovation hubs attracting capital

Dubai’s emergence as a fintech and innovation hub has lured tech-savvy millionaires and venture capital. With dedicated free zones like Dubai Internet City and accelerators focused on startups, the city fosters cutting-edge developments that appeal to forward-thinking investors.

Impact on local economy and job market

The influx of wealthy individuals stimulates the local economy, generating demand for luxury goods, services, and skilled labor. This dynamic supports the creation of high-paying jobs and promotes entrepreneurship, thereby boosting overall economic health despite global uncertainties.

Diversification of millionaire origins

Millionaires relocating to Dubai come from an increasingly diverse range of countries, including Asia, Europe, and North America. This cosmopolitan influx reinforces Dubai’s status as a global city while enriching its cultural and business ecosystems.

Government initiatives supporting long-term residency

To sustain this inflow of affluent individuals, the government has introduced long-term visa schemes and investor-friendly policies. These initiatives provide millionaires with stability and incentives to establish long-term residence and contribute to Dubai’s growth trajectory.
